TLA Releases ‘Little Maverick’ Graphic Novel List

December 6, 2019 by Brigid Alverson   Leave a Comment

The Texas Library Association’s Children’s Round Table has released its Little Maverick Graphic Novel List, list of 52 graphic novels that are recommended reading for children in kindergarten through fifth grade. It’s a splendid list, and it is even more useful because it breaks the books out into age categories. The list is below, and we’re adding links to reviews, catalog pages, and other info in case you want to know more.

* Titles received a unanimous vote from the selection committee
+ Title is part of a series

GRADES K-5

About Brigid Alverson

Brigid Alverson, the editor of the Good Comics for Kids blog, has been reading comics since she was 4. She has an MFA in printmaking and has worked as a book editor and a newspaper reporter; now she is assistant to the mayor of Melrose, Massachusetts. In addition to editing GC4K, she writes about comics and graphic novels at MangaBlog, SLJTeen, Publishers Weekly Comics World, Comic Book Resources, MTV Geek, and Good E-Reader.com. Brigid is married to a physicist and has two daughters in college, which is why she writes so much. She was a judge for the 2012 Eisner Awards.
